SunanAlTermithi-017-001-8073Simak Bin Harb narrated: A person from the offspring of Umm Hani narrated to me - I met one of the most virtuous among them; and his name was Jadah; and Umm Hani was his grandmother - he narrated to me from his grandmother that the Messenger of Allah entered upon her and asked for some drink; and he drank. Then he offered it to her and she drank it. Then she said: O Messenger of Allah! I was fasting. So the Messenger of Allah said: The one fasting a voluntary fast is the trustee for himself; if he wishes he fasts; and if he wishes he breaks. Shubah one of the narrators said: I said to him Jadah ; Did you hear this from Umm Hani? He said: No Abu Salih and our family informed us of it from Umm Hani.The Chapter on Makkah And Praise Allah in HodHood Indexing, Chapter on What Has Been Related About Breaking The Voluntary Fast in Sunan AlTermithi

SunanAlTermithi-017-001-9810Qabisah Bin Dhuwaib said: A grandmother - the mother of a mother; or the mother of a father - came to Abu Bakr and she said: a son of my son - or; a son of my daughter died; and I have been informed that there is a right from the wealth for me in the Book. So Abu Bakr said: I do not find that there is a right for you in the Book; and I havent heard that the Messenger of Allah S.A.W judged anything for you. I shall ask the people. So; AlMughirah Bin Shubah testified that the Messenger of Allah S.A.W gave her case a sixth. He said: And who heard that along with you? He said: Muhammad Bin Maslamah. He said: So he gave her a sixth. Then the other grandmother who was left behind came to Umar. Sufyan said: And Mamar said to me in addition; from AlZuhri - and I do not remember it to be from A-Zuhri; rather I remember it to be from Mamar - that Umar said: If the two of you are together then it is for both of you; and whichever of you is alone with it the sixth ; then it is for her.The Chapter on Charity To Brothers And Mother in HodHood Indexing, The Book Of Inheritance in Sunan AlTermithi
SunanAlTermithi-017-001-9811Qabisah Bin Dhuwaib said: A grandmother came to Abu Bakr to ask him about her inheritance. He said to her; There is noting for you in the Book of Allah and there is nothing for you in the Sunnah of the Messenger of Allah S.A.W. So ;return until I ask the people. So he asked the people and AlMughirah Bin Shubah said: I was present when the Messenger of Allah S.A.W gave her case a sixth. So he said: Was anyone else with you? Muhammad Bin Maslamah stood to say the same as what AlMughirah Bin Shubah said. So Abu Bakr implemented that for her. Then the other grandmother came to Umar Bin AlKhattab to ask him about her inheritance. He said: There is nothing in the Book of Allah for you; but there is that sixth. So if the two of you are together then it is for both of you; and whichever of you remains ; then it is for her.The Chapter on Inheritance And Grandmothers in HodHood Indexing, The Book Of Inheritance in Sunan AlTermithi

SunanAbuDawoud-017-001-28915Narrated Qabisah Ibn Dhuwayb: A grandmother came to Abu Bakr asking him for her share of inheritance. He said: There is nothing prescribed for you in Allah Book; nor do I know anything for you in the Sunnah of the Prophet of Allah ﷺ Go home till I question the people. He then questioned the people; and AlMughirah Ibn Shubah said: I had been present with the Messenger of Allah ﷺ when he gave grandmother a sixth. Abu Bakr said: Is there anyone with you? Muhammad Ibn Maslamah stood and said the same as AlMughirah Ibn Shubah had said. So Abu Bakr made it apply to her. Another grandmother came to Umar Ibn AlKhattab asking him for her share of inheritance. He said: Nothing has been prescribed for you in Allah Book. The decision made before you was made for a grandmother other than you. I am not going to add in the shares of inheritance; but it is that sixth. If there are two of you; it is shared between you; but whichever of you is the only one left gets it all.The Chapter on Inheritance And Grandmothers in HodHood Indexing, Chapter on Regarding The Grandmother in Sunan Abu Dawoud
SunanAbuDawoud-017-001-29341Narrated Qaylah bint Makhramah: Abdullah IbnHassan AlAnbari said: My grandmothers; Safiyah and Duhaybah; narrated to me; that hey were the daughters of Ulaybah and were nourished by Qaylah; daughter of Makhramah. She was the grandmother of their father. She reported to them; saying: We came upon the Messenger of Allah ﷺ. My companion; Hurayth Ibn Hassan; came to him as a delegate from Bakr Ibn Wail. He took the oath of allegiance of Islam for himself and for his people. He then said: Messenger of Allah ﷺ ; write a document for us; giving us the land lying between us and Banu Tamim at AlDahna to the effect that not one of them will cross it in our direction except a traveller or a passer-by. He said: Write down AlDahna for them; boy. When I saw that he passed orders to give it to him; I became anxious; for it was my native land and my home. I said: Messenger of Allah; he did not ask you for a true border when he asked you. This land of Dahna is a place where the camels have their home; and it is a pasture for the sheep. The women of Banu Tamim and their children are beyond it. He said: Stop; boy! A poor woman spoke the truth: a Muslim is a brother of a Muslim. Each one of them may benefit from water and trees; and they should cooperate with each other against Satan.The Chapter on Farming And Irrigation And Earth in HodHood Indexing, Chapter on Allocation Of Land in Sunan Abu Dawoud
SunanAbuDawoud-017-001-29776Narrated Umm Ziyad: Hashraj Ibn Ziyad reported on the authority of his grandmother that she went out with the Messenger of Allah ﷺ for the battle of Khaybar. They were six in number including herself. She said : When the Messenger of Allah ﷺ was informed about it; he sent for us. We came to him; and found him angry. He said: With whom did you come out; and by whose permission did you come out? We said: Messenger of Allah; we have come out to spin the hair; by which we provide aid in the cause of Allah. We have medicine for the wounded; we hand arrows to the fighters ; and supply drink made of wheat or barley. He said: Stand up. When Allah bestowed victory of Khaybar on him; he allotted shares to us from spoils that he allotted to the men. He Hashraj Ibn Ziyad said: I said to her: Grandmother; what was that? She replied: Dates.The Chapter on Booties Of Almaghazi in HodHood Indexing, Chapter on Regarding A Woman And A Slave Being Given Something From The Spoils in Sunan Abu Dawoud

MuwataMalik-017-001-35144Yahya related to me from Malik from Ibn Shihab from Uthman Ibn Ishaq Ibn Kharasha that Qabisa Ibn Dhuayb said; A grandmother came to Abu Bakr AlSiddiq and asked him for her inheritance. Abu Bakr said to her; You have nothing in the Book of Allah; and I do not know that you have anything in the sunna of the Messenger of Allah; may Allah bless him and grant him peace. Go away therefore; until I have questioned the people. i.e.the Companions. He questioned the people; and AlMughira Ibn Shuba said; I was present with the Messenger of Allah; may Allah bless him and grant him peace; when he gave the grandmother a sixth. Abu Bakr said; Was there anybody else with you? Muhammad Ibn Maslama AlAnsari stood up and said the like of what AlMughira said. Abu Bakr AlSiddiq gave it to her. Then the other grandmother came to Umar Ibn AlKhattab and asked him for her inheritance. He said to her; You have nothing in the Book of Allah; and what has been decided is only for other than you; and I am not one to add to the fixed shares; other than that sixth. If there are two of you together; it is between you. If eitherof you is left alone with it; it is hers.The Chapter on Inheritance And Grandmothers in HodHood Indexing, The Book of Hudud in Muwata Malik
MuwataMalik-017-001-35146Yahya related to me from Malik from Abdu Rabbih Ibn Said that Abu Bakr Ibn Abdulrahman Ibn AlHarith Ibn Hisham only gave a fixed share to two grandmothers together. Malik said; The generally agreed on way of doing things among us in which there is no dispute and which I saw the people of knowledge in our city doing; is that the maternal grandmother does not inherit anything at all with the mother. Outside of that; she is given a sixth as a fixed share. The paternal grandmotherdoes not inherit anything along with the mother or the father. Outside of that she is given a sixth as a fixed share. If both the paternal grandmother and maternal grandmother are alive; and the deceased does not have a father or mother outside of them; Malik said;.I have heard that if the maternal grandmother is the nearest of the two of them; then she has a sixth instead of the paternal grandmother. If the paternal grandmother is nearer; or they are in the same position in relation to the deceased; the sixth is divided equally between them. Malik said; None of the female grand-relations except for these two has any inheritance because I have heard that the Messenger of Allah; may Allah bless him and grant him peace; gave the grandmother inheritance; and then Abu Bakr asked about that until someone reliable related from the Messenger of Allah; may Allah bless him and grant him peace; that he had made the grandmother an heir and given a share to her. Another grandmother came to Umar Ibn AlKhattab; and he said; I am not one to add to fixed shares. If there are two of you together; it is between you. If either of you is left alone with it; it is hers. Malik said; We do not know of anyone who made other than the two grandmothers heirs from the beginning of Islam to this day.The Chapter on Inheritance And Grandmothers in HodHood Indexing, The Book of Hudud in Muwata Malik
